What Elements Make a Basketball Shoe Look Great?

When considering what elements make a basketball shoe look great, several design features come into play:

  • Colorway: The color palette of a shoe significantly impacts its visual appeal. A well-chosen combination of colors can make a shoe stand out on the court and complement a player’s uniform, while unique patterns or gradients can add an artistic flair.
  • Silhouette: The shape and cut of the shoe contribute to its overall aesthetic. Sleek, low-profile designs are often associated with speed and agility, while higher cuts can convey strength and support, catering to different player preferences and styles.
  • Materials: The choice of materials not only affects the shoe’s performance but also its appearance. Premium materials like leather or innovative synthetic fabrics can elevate the look, while mesh or knit panels can provide a modern, breathable touch.
  • Branding and Logos: The placement and design of logos play a crucial role in a shoe’s attractiveness. Subtle, well-integrated branding can enhance the shoe’s look, while bold logos can make a statement, appealing to fans of specific brands or athletes.
  • Detailing and Accents: Unique design elements such as stitching patterns, reflective materials, or unexpected textures can add depth to a shoe’s appearance. These details can set a model apart from others, making it a conversation starter on and off the court.
  • Performance Features: Elements like visible air units, innovative lacing systems, or interesting outsole designs not only serve functional purposes but can also contribute to the shoe’s aesthetic. When these features are designed thoughtfully, they can enhance the overall look while maintaining the shoe’s performance integrity.

Which Basketball Shoes Have Set Design Trends Over the Years?

Several basketball shoes have set design trends over the years, influencing both performance and style on and off the court:

  • Nike Air Jordan 1: This iconic shoe revolutionized basketball sneaker design with its high-top silhouette and bold colorways.
  • Adidas Superstar: Originally a basketball shoe, the Superstar became a cultural icon, known for its distinctive shell toe and minimalistic design.
  • Puma Clyde: Named after basketball legend Walt “Clyde” Frazier, this sneaker introduced a more casual style to the basketball shoe market, featuring a low-cut design and suede upper.
  • Nike Air Force 1: Although primarily a lifestyle sneaker, the Air Force 1 influenced basketball shoe aesthetics with its chunky silhouette and versatile styling options.
  • Converse Chuck Taylor All Star: As one of the oldest and most recognizable basketball shoes, it set trends with its simple canvas design and rubber toe cap, transcending into a fashion staple.
  • Under Armour Curry One: Stephen Curry’s first signature shoe combined performance features with a sleek design that appealed to both athletes and sneaker enthusiasts.

The Nike Air Jordan 1, released in 1985, is often credited with bridging the gap between basketball performance and streetwear fashion. Its high-top design provided ankle support, while the vibrant colorways allowed players to express their individuality, setting a precedent for future signature shoes.

The Adidas Superstar, launched in 1969, was initially designed for basketball but found its place in hip-hop culture during the 1980s. Its clean lines and recognizable shell toe made it a timeless classic that remains popular today, illustrating how basketball shoes can influence broader fashion trends.

Puma Clyde emerged in the 1970s when Walt Frazier requested a shoe tailored to his style, leading to a low-profile silhouette that catered to both on-court performance and off-court style. This shoe’s suede material and casual aesthetic made it a precursor to many lifestyle sneakers that followed.

The Nike Air Force 1 debuted in 1982 and became a cultural phenomenon, largely due to its versatility and bold silhouette. While it was designed for basketball, its appeal quickly spread to various subcultures, cementing its status as a must-have sneaker in both sports and fashion.

The Converse Chuck Taylor All Star has been around since the early 20th century, originally designed for basketball players. Its simple design and affordability made it a favorite among players and fans alike, helping it evolve into an enduring fashion statement across generations.

The Under Armour Curry One, released in 2015, was notable for its blend of innovative performance technology and sleek aesthetics. Designed specifically for Stephen Curry’s playing style, the shoe’s popularity helped elevate Under Armour’s presence in the basketball market and set a new standard for performance-driven designs.
